在当今互联网环境中,使用代理工具可以帮助用户保护隐私,安全访问被封锁的网站。V2Ray是一个强大的代理软件,而Xui是一个基于Web的管理工具,可以大大简化V2Ray的配置过程。本文将详细介绍如何利用Xui搭建V2Ray服务器。
第1章:搭建V2Ray的准备工作
在开始搭建V2Ray之前,有几个准备工作是必要的:
- 确定你的服务器环境(如云服务器、VPS等)
- 具备基本的命令行使用知识
- 了解V2Ray及其用法
- 准备好放置配置文件的目录
第2章:安装V2Ray
2.1 获得V2Ray
你可以从V2Ray的官方网站直接下载安装包。使用以下命令:
bash bash <(curl -L -s https://install.direct/go.sh)
2.2 安装依赖
在安装V2Ray之前,首先需要确认你的服务器中已经安装了以下依赖:
curl
ws-utils
可以使用以下命令进行安装:
bash sudo apt-get update sudo apt-get install curl -y sudo apt-get install -y ws-utils
第3章:使用Xui配置V2Ray
3.1 安装Xui面板
为了更轻松地管理V2Ray,推荐使用Xui管理面板。在终端中执行以下命令安装Xui:
bash cd /var/www; git clone https://github.com/rixen/v2ray-ui.git; cd v2ray-ui; chmod +x install.sh; ./install.sh;
Xui安装完成后,你将能够通过172.16.92.200:8080访问它(IP会根据你的服务器配置而有所不同)。
3.2 登录和创建配置
访问Xui的管理控制台,需要使用默认用户名和密码登录。之后你可以:
- 创建一个新的Server实例
- 配置用户和密码(可选)
- 设定不同的传输协议
第4章:V2Ray配置解析
4.1 V2Ray核心配置项
- inbounds:设置接收流量的方式。
- outbounds:配置怎样转发流量至目标。
- routing:配置流量的路由规则。
以上各项的合理配置可以有效提高V2Ray的使用效率。
4.2 Xui操作中的重要选项
- 启用/禁用用户认证:保护你的V2Ray不被未经授权的用户访问。
- 选择传输协议:如TCP,WebSocket等。
第5章:测试V2Ray的配置
安装并配置好V2Ray后,你需要测试其工作是否正常。可以通过以下几种方式进行测试:
- 使用命令行工具如
curl
- 通过浏览器直接访问需翻墙的网站
- 查看日志文件 given_error.log来确认具体的出错信息
第6章:解决常见问题
6.1 无法连接的解决方法
- 确认防火墙设置
- 检查V2Ray服务状态
- 确保没有网络问题
6.2 连接速度慢的原因及优化
- 优化服务器响应网络路径
- 确保使用的传输协议配置合理
常见问答(FAQ)
Q1: 我能在Xui中添加多个V2Ray服务器吗?
A1: 是的,你可以在Xui管理界面中添加多个服务器,同时进行管理。
Q2: 使用V2Ray的最高带宽限制是什么?
A2: 带宽限制主要取决于你的VPS提供商和配置,V2Ray本身没有特定限制。
Q3: 如何确保V2Ray安全性?
A3: 确保用强密码和启用V2Ray加密,通过WebSocket等 protocolos及时更新软件版本。
Q4: 可以在手机上使用V2Ray吗?
A4: 是的,推荐使用V2Ray相关的移动应用程序(如行者)连接你的v2ray服务。
Q5: 如果错误退回应该怎么办?
A5: 可以访问V2Ray的官方Github站点,在issue部分询问相关问题。
小结
通过本指南,你已经学习了如何使用Xui成功搭建V2Ray。记住,确保定期检查你的V2Ray服务器配置以及相关网络安全。希望这篇文章能对你有所帮助!